Developing a Robust Risk Management Strategy

Perhaps the most crucial element of long-term success is the implementation of a robust risk management strategy. The potential for financial loss is inherent in these types of platforms and a careless approach can quickly lead to depleted resources. It’s essential to establish clear boundaries for your investment and to adhere to them rigorously. Determining a bankroll – a dedicated fund specifically for participation in these contests – is the first step. Never risk more than a small percentage of your bankroll on any single contest. A common guideline is to limit your exposure to 1-5% per contest, depending on your risk tolerance and the perceived probability of success. Moreover, avoid chasing losses – the temptation to recoup setbacks by increasing your stakes can quickly escalate into larger problems.

The Role of Diversification and Position Sizing

Diversification is another key principle of sound risk management. Don’t put all your eggs in one basket. Spreading your investments across a variety of contests and game types can help mitigate the impact of unfavorable outcomes in any single event. Furthermore, position sizing – the amount of your bankroll allocated to each contest – should be carefully considered. Higher-probability contests may warrant slightly larger stakes, while riskier endeavors should be approached with greater caution. Regularly reviewing and adjusting your risk management strategy is essential, adapting to changing market conditions and your own evolving performance.

  • Set a strict bankroll and never exceed it.
  • Limit stake size to 1-5% of bankroll per contest.
  • Avoid chasing losses with increased wagers.
  • Diversify investments across different contests.
  • Regularly review and adjust your strategy.

Following these guidelines can significantly improve your chances of long-term sustainability and profitability.
